[Python]“别人造好的轮子”,python常用第三方库——python自动办公7( 二 )
本文插图
矩阵计算
pandas是数据分析常用的库 , 它是基于numpy 的一种工具 。 pandas 纳入了大量其它库和一些标准的数据模型 , 提供了高效地操作大型数据集所需的工具 , 还提供了能使我们快速便捷地处理数据的函数和方法 。 值得一提的是 , 这个库的工具中集成了读写数据的接口 , 可以对接Excel表格 , CSV , JSON , Pickle等数据类型 。
3.可视化绘图——matplotlib
matplotlib 是一个 python 的 2D绘图库 , 它以各种硬拷贝格式和跨平台的交互式环境生成出版质量级别的图形 。 通过matplotlib , 开发者可以仅需要几行代码 , 便可以生成绘图 , 直方图 , 功率谱 , 条形图 , 错误图 , 散点图等 。
本文插图
数据可视化
4.Excel处理——xlrd + xlwt + xlutils库
xlrd和xlwt是读写Excel表格的两个常用库 。 xlrd能够实现按sheet页读取表格中的内容 , 配合numpy , pandas库对表格数据进行处理 。 xlwt则可以新建一个Excel文件 , 将处理结果写入到这个文件中 。 xlutils是为了解决在已有的Excel文件中再追加写入数据的问题 。
本文插图
表格处理
5.Word处理——docx库
docx是word文件的后缀名 , 但是在python中 , 它是一个用于创建和更新微软Word文件的库 。 docx是一个很强大的库 , 可以创建docx文档 , 包含段落、分页符、表格、图片、标题、样式等等 , 基本上等于是用代码在操作word文档 。
本文插图
批量操作文档
6.数据库读写——pymysql
pymysql是基于ORM(对象关系映射)模型开发的用来连接MySQL数据库服务器的一个库 。 通过pymysql操作数据库不需要写SQL语句 , 用python语言就能够操作数据库的增删改查 。
本文插图
连接并操作数据库
本文这里只是对今后所要将的第三方库做了一次简要的汇总 , 让大家对自动办公所需的包有一个大概认识 。 具体每个库怎么使用 , 或者还会添加一些这里没介绍到的库 , 会在相应阶段的后面的文章中详细说明 。 本文内容就此告一段落 , 后面的文章咱们正式进入Excel的操作 。
【[Python]“别人造好的轮子”,python常用第三方库——python自动办公7】 下期预告:python操作Excel表格
- 刘宇宁 刘宇宁开启「暖·愈」篇章,《全世界最好的你》原声带将上线酷狗
- 人造太阳@中国“人造太阳”实现1亿度运行,这可能是永久解决能源问题的黑科技
- 十大突破性技术-NMN,叫你如何选择最好的NMN
- 2020最好的网络机顶盒:人气爆棚的五款型号推荐
- #国家卫健委#国家卫健委:境外输入病例的关联病例,基本系中转或居家隔离中传染他人造成
- 『实体经济守望者』不想给别人打工、又没有好的创业项目,怎么办?,人到中年
- 「科技日报」中国人造太阳获重大突破;南极洲9000万年前或为雨林
- [趣旅游]就来美丽的三都岛,心情不好的朋友来看看吧,探寻海上的田园之美
- 「量子位」淘汰人工审核,自动给arXiv打分,船新论文评审Python程序
- Python@船新论文评审Python程序,淘汰人工审核,自动给arXiv打分